Modernism and Abstraction: Treasures from the Smithsonian American Art Museum

January 3, 2000 – May 29, 2003

Modernism and Abstraction features art related to radical transformations in the 20th century, from emerging technologies to new political theories. Included are works by Joseph Stella, Georgia O'Keeffe, Max Weber, Jan Matulka, Lois Mailou Jones, Stuart Davis, Marsden Hartley, Arthur Dove, Willem de Kooning, Franz Kline, Clyfford Still, Richard Diebenkorn, Nathan Oliveira, Kenneth Noland, Sam Gilliam, Jennifer Bartlett, Eric Fischl, and David Hockney.
